Data Protection Manager | Healthcare & Pharma | £50-60k

We're currently supporting a leading health & pharma organisation that is continuing to strengthen its data protection and information governance capability.

This role will play a key part in ensuring the organisation maintains strong compliance with UK GDPR, the Data Protection Act 2018, and wider information governance frameworks, while supporting teams across the business to embed data protection by design and default.

Location: Wembley (2 days onsite)

Package: £50-60k + competitive package with up to 40 days annual leave

Key Responsibilities:

  • Act as a senior advisor on UK GDPR and Data Protection Act 2018 compliance
  • Lead and review Data Protection Impact Assessments (DPIAs), Legitimate Interest Assessments (LIAs) and Data Transfer Impact Assessments (TIAs)
  • Maintain and develop Records of Processing Activities (RoPA)
  • Manage data breach investigations and regulatory reporting, including ICO notifications where required
  • Support responses to Subject Access Requests (SARs), FOI and individual rights requests
  • Deliver privacy training and awareness programmes across the organisation
  • Support the development and maintenance of information governance frameworks and policies
  • Work with technology and cyber teams to ensure privacy is embedded across digital services and platforms
  • Support compliance with ISO 27001 / ISO 27701 and other relevant regulatory frameworks

Key Skills & Experience:

  • Strong experience working in data protection or information governance roles
  • Excellent knowledge of UK GDPR and Data Protection Act 2018
  • Hands-on experience leading DPIAs, RoPAs and privacy impact assessments
  • Experience managing data breaches and regulatory reporting
  • Familiarity with SARs, FOI and individual rights requests
  • Experience delivering privacy training and stakeholder engagement
  • Strong communication skills with the ability to advise senior stakeholders
  • Experience within pharma, life sciences or similar regulated sectors
